What Are Moles?
Moles are dark spots that form when skin cells cluster together. Most moles won’t hurt you. But it’s good to know what normal moles look like. This helps you spot any changes that might need attention.
Your body creates moles when certain cells grow close together. These cells make the brown color in your skin. Some moles are flat against your skin. Others stick out a bit. Both types are normal.
Some moles show up when you’re born. Others appear as you get older. The sun can make new moles form on your skin. That’s why people who spend time outside often have more moles.
Common Types of Moles
Each type of mole looks slightly different. Flat moles are most common. They’re usually brown or black. Raised moles stick up from the skin. Some moles have hair growing from them.
Birth moles are present when babies are born. They can be any size. Some are quite large. These moles need careful watching as you grow older.
Acquired moles develop over time. Most people get new moles until age 40. These moles are usually small and round. They shouldn’t change much once they appear.

Advanced Removal Methods
Sydney doctors use several methods to remove moles. Each method works best for certain types. Your doctor will choose the right method for your mole.
Cutting the mole out works well for deeper moles. The doctor numbs your skin first. Then they remove the whole mole. This method lets them test the mole tissue.
Laser removal works for flat, brown moles. The laser breaks down the mole’s pigment. Your body then removes the pigment naturally. This method usually leaves less scarring.

After-Removal Care
Healing Time
Your skin needs proper care after mole removal. Most spots heal within two weeks. Following care instructions speeds up healing.
Keep the area clean and dry. Use any creams your doctor gives you. Avoid touching or scratching the spot. This helps prevent infection.
Sun protection is extra important while healing. Cover the area when outside. Use strong sunscreen. This helps prevent dark marks from forming.
